Understanding Auto Window Tinting

What is Auto Window Tint?

Auto window tint is a thin film that is applied to the glass surfaces of vehicles to enhance privacy, reduce glare, and provide protection against harmful UV rays. This film can vary in materials, colors, and thickness, allowing vehicle owners to customize their tint according to preferences, needs, and legal restrictions in their area. The installation can be performed professionally or as a DIY project, depending on the skill level and desired outcome.

Choosing the Right Tint for Your Vehicle

Types of Window Tint Films

There is a variety of window tint films available, each with unique properties. The major types include:

  • Dyed Window Film: Affordable and popular for reducing light entry, though it may fade over time.
  • Metalized Window Film: Embeds small metal particles which reflect heat and increase strength, but may interfere with signal reception.
  • Carbon Window Film: Provides UV protection without fading and does not interfere with signals, making it a sturdy choice.
  • Ceramic Window Film: Offers superior heat rejection and UV protection without the drawbacks of metallic films; ideal for high performance.

Legal Regulations for Tinting

Understanding legal regulations is crucial before investing in auto window tint. Various countries and states have their own specific laws regarding the percentage of tint allowed. Typically, the laws cover:

  • Visible Light Transmission (VLT): Each state specifies a percentage that can allow light to pass through the window. For instance, some states may allow 35%, while others may allow 25%.
  • Reflectivity: Some regulations limit how reflective the tint can be, influencing heat rejection.
  • Windshield Tint: Many places have restrictions regarding windshield tinting, often allowing only a clear band across the top.

Cost Comparison: DIY vs. Professional

When considering costs, DIY kits typically range from $50 to $200, while professional installation could cost between $200 and $800. While DIY options may seem more appealing financially, remember that professional work usually comes with a warranty and superior quality.

Maintaining Your Window Tint

Tips for Care and Maintenance

To ensure longevity, it’s vital to follow maintenance tips:

  • Avoid rolling down windows for at least 48 hours after installation.
  • Use gentle cleaning agents specifically designed for tinted windows; avoid ammonia-based products.
  • Regularly inspect your tint for bubbles, peeling, or discoloration.

Signs that Your Tint Needs Replacement

Identifying when to replace your tint is crucial for preserving your vehicle’s comfort and appearance. Key signs include:

  • Bubbling: This indicates poor adhesion, requiring a replacement.
  • Fading: If the tint color has significantly lightened, it may be time for a fresh application.
  • Peeling Edges: Edges that have lifted can diminish aesthetics and may require renewal.
